Output f6df6cd1c95232e341f51a1fb11d077c942c5b4612113b51a9ee9a13bb5f65cd:0

value
100606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e8ef643db6bea54c0d472133c8e6fec041d5e4c OP_EQUAL
address
3DECKtN7wrwWgk1simcdT52QJFvQ6MRXKG
transaction
f6df6cd1c95232e341f51a1fb11d077c942c5b4612113b51a9ee9a13bb5f65cd
confirmations
239773
spent
true